    Brief Narrative
    Ehrenkreuz der Deutschen Mutter [Cross of Honor of the German Mother] medal was instituted by the Nazi Party in 1938 as a propaganda measure to promote National Socialist population policy. This medal is a 3rd class order, Bronze Cross. There were three classes of medal: gold, for eight or more children, silver, for six to seven children, and bronze for four to five children. Recipients were nominated by Nazi Party or government officials and had to be pure Germans, of good character, politically and socially. The first awards were in 1939 to some 3 million German mothers, the last in 1944.

    Physical Description
    Bronze, cross pattee styled medal with an elongated lower arm. In the center is a black enamel swastika on a white circular field surrounded by raised, bronze-colored German text. A square, bronze sunburst emanates from the circle, filling the space between the cross arms. The arms are blue enamel with a white border. A ribbon with a central wide blue stripe flanked by narrow white, blue, white stripes is threaded through a rectangular metal loop on the top of the cross. It is not sewn closed. There is text engraved on the reverse.
